Some unvaccinated Australians won’t be able to browse in the shops until 2023. That’s a worry – The Conversation AU
It’s unvaccinated people, not the vaccinated, who are most at risk when unvaccinated people are allowed in shops.

Unvaccinated Victorians have a grace period of about three weeks to go on a shopping spree before theyre no longer permitted to enter non-essential retail from November 24, according to the states roadmap out of restrictions.
